Output 3d149d0fc9c16fd67ffd80d71df8e68490495cbba8ff1d7ca2e911f617ed49d4:24

value
4338336
script pubkey
OP_0 OP_PUSHBYTES_20 bedc3955980719b9a1aa02232179b1f48e7e6bb0
address
bc1qhmwrj4vcquvmngd2qg3jz7d37j88u6ascpdw5z
transaction
3d149d0fc9c16fd67ffd80d71df8e68490495cbba8ff1d7ca2e911f617ed49d4
confirmations
304732
spent
true